Output 68ecab8269fe65029e42677572127580fa24b2e4a562fcd06ac8129af461ed12:0

value
319725011
script pubkey
OP_0 OP_PUSHBYTES_20 d00ba1589723c1af5b61e98fa0300900513eaaba
address
bc1q6q96zkyhy0q67kmpax86qvqfqpgna246a50stj
transaction
68ecab8269fe65029e42677572127580fa24b2e4a562fcd06ac8129af461ed12